Expertise in welding electrode production involves a thorough understanding of metallurgy and welding technology. Leading manufacturers invest heavily in research and development to innovate and refine their product lines. These companies often employ teams of skilled engineers and materials scientists who work collaboratively to develop electrodes that meet specific standards and applications. Expertise also ensures that manufacturers can offer a wide range of electrodes suitable for different welding processes, such as SMAW, TIG, or MIG, and for diverse materials like stainless steel, aluminum, or cast iron. Understanding these nuances empowers manufacturers to provide products that excel in various operational conditions.
